Dfs best case time complexity

WebMar 4, 2024 · Time complexity is commonly estimated by counting the number of elementary operations performed by the algorithm, supposing that each elementary … WebApr 10, 2024 · Best Case: It is defined as the condition that allows an algorithm to complete statement execution in the shortest amount of time. In this case, the execution time serves as a lower bound on the algorithm's time complexity. Average Case: You add the running times for each possible input combination and take the average in the average case.

DFS Time Complexity DFS Meaning - School Of Beginners

WebDec 26, 2024 · Big-O, commonly written as O, is an Asymptotic Notation for the worst case, or ceiling of growth for a given function. It provides us with an asymptotic upper bound for the growth rate of the runtime of an algorithm. Developers typically solve for the worst case scenario, Big O, because you’re not expecting your algorithm to run in the best ... WebMar 24, 2024 · Time Complexity In the worst-case scenario, DFS creates a search tree whose depth is , so its time complexity is . Since BFS is optimal, its worst-case … diabetes and cardiac medication carvedilol https://steffen-hoffmann.net

Time & Space Complexity of Dijkstra

WebO ( d ) {\displaystyle O (d)} [1] : 5. In computer science, iterative deepening search or more specifically iterative deepening depth-first search [2] (IDS or IDDFS) is a state space /graph search strategy in which a depth-limited version of depth-first search is run repeatedly with increasing depth limits until the goal is found. WebIn this article, we will be discussing Time and Space Complexity of most commonly used binary tree operations like insert, search and delete for worst, best and average case. Table of contents: Introduction to Binary Tree. Introduction to Time and Space Complexity. Insert operation in Binary Tree. Worst Case Time Complexity of Insertion. WebAverage Case Time Complexity. The average case doesn't change the steps we have to take since the array isn't sorted, we do not know the costs between each node. Therefore it will remain O(V^2) since. V calculations; O(V) time; Total: O(V^2) Best Case Time Complexity. The same situation occurs in best case since again the array is unsorted: V ... diabetes and carbohydrates per meal

DFS vs BFS (in detail) - OpenGenus IQ: Computing …

Category:Depth-First Search vs. Breadth-First Search Baeldung on

Tags:Dfs best case time complexity

Dfs best case time complexity

Time complexity of depth-first graph algorithm - Stack Overflow

WebMar 28, 2024 · Time complexity: O (V + E), where V is the number of vertices and E is the number of edges in the graph. Auxiliary Space: O (V + E), since an extra visited array of size V is required, And stack size for … WebFeb 15, 2014 · Time complexity = O(b^m). Space complexity = O(mb) if when we visit a node, we push.stack all its neighbours. O(m) if we only push.stack one of the child when we expand the frontier.

Dfs best case time complexity

Did you know?

WebNov 11, 2024 · Accessing a cell in the matrix is an operation, so the complexity is in the best-case, average-case, and worst-case scenarios. If we store the graph as an … WebMar 24,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ebThe time complexity of DFS is O (V + E) where V is the number of vertices and E is the number of edges. This is because in the worst case, the algorithm explores each vertex and edge exactly once. The space … WebWe would like to show you a description here but the site won’t allow us.

WebThe higher the branching factor, the lower the overhead of repeatedly expanded states, [1] : 6 but even when the branching factor is 2, iterative deepening search only takes about … WebMay 22, 2024 · It measure’s the worst case or the longest amount of time an algorithm can possibly take to complete. For example: We have an algorithm that has O (n²) as time complexity, then it is also true ...

WebThe space complexity of a depth-first search is lower than that of a breadth first search. Completeness This is a complete algorithm because if there exists a solution, it will be …

WebApr 20,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. cinc underwearWebNov 11, 2024 · Therefore, the time complexity checking the presence of an edge in the adjacency list is . Let’s assume that an algorithm often requires checking the presence of an arbitrary edge in a graph. Also, time … diabetes and carpal tunnel syndromeWebApr 6, 2016 · Depth First Search has a time complexity of O(b^m), where b is the maximum branching factor of the search tree and m is the maximum depth of the state space. Terrible if m is much larger than d, but if search tree is "bushy", may be much faster than Breadth … cincy 30 day weathercinc work order systemWebNov 28, 2024 · Time Complexity of DFS / BFS to search all vertices = O(E + V) Reason: O(1) for all neither, O(1) for select edges, for in both aforementioned cases, DFS and BFS, we are going to traverse each edge only once and also each vertex only once from you don’t visit an already visited guest. A DFS will only store as great memory over the stack as is ... cinc websitesWebDepth-first search ( D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some arbitrary node as the root node in the case of a graph) and explores as … diabetes and cataracts in dogsWebNov 9, 2024 · The given graph is represented as an adjacency matrix. Here stores the weight of edge .; The priority queue is represented as an unordered list.; Let and be the number of edges and vertices in the … diabetes and cdl license